Trust & Safety

Cache exists to connect candidates and recruiters honestly. This page explains the rules recruiters agree to, the consent candidates keep over their own profiles, what Cache does and does not promise, and how we act when someone breaks the rules.

Recruiter Standards

Every recruiter on Cache agrees to a small set of ground rules. These are not aspirations. They are conditions for keeping an account.

  • Real company, real role. Recruiters must use their actual company name, their actual title, and describe roles that actually exist. No shell companies, no invented positions, no bait postings used to collect resumes.
  • No spam or misleading messages. Do not send bulk, templated, or off-topic messages. Do not misrepresent salary, work authorization support, location, remote status, or the stage of the hiring process.
  • No harassment. No repeated contact after a candidate has declined, no personal attacks, no discriminatory language, no pressure tactics.
  • No misuse of candidate data. Candidate profiles, contact details, resumes, and messages are for evaluating people for the role you contacted them about. They are not for resale, for outside marketing lists, for training external models, or for sharing outside your hiring team.
  • No payment requests from candidates. A recruiter on Cache will never ask a candidate for money — not for an interview, not for a placement, not for training, equipment, visa processing, background checks, or any other reason. This is a hard line. If it happens, report it.

Candidate Consent

A candidate profile on Cache belongs to the candidate. Recruiters see a limited view (name, general skills, education level) when browsing. The full profile — resume, contact details, project detail, links — is shared with a specific recruiter only when the candidate opts in for that role, whether by applying, accepting a match, or approving a share request.

Candidates can withdraw consent at any time from their profile settings. Withdrawing consent removes future access; it does not retract information a recruiter has already viewed while consent was in place.

What Cache Does Not Promise

Cache is a tool for finding matches and running a cleaner hiring process. It is not a guarantee of any outcome. Cache does not guarantee interviews, job offers, hiring decisions, salary, visa sponsorship, or continued employment. Matching scores and AI suggestions are aids, not verdicts — every real decision is made by the recruiter or the candidate.

Paying for a subscription does not change ranking, matching, or recruiter behaviour. See our Terms of Service for the full disclaimer.

Enforcement — Three-Strike Policy

Reports of recruiter misconduct are reviewed by Cache. For ordinary violations of the Recruiter Standards above, we follow a three-strike approach:

  • Strike 1 — Warning. Written notice of the specific behaviour, what rule it broke, and what to change. The account continues.
  • Strike 2 — Restriction. Temporary loss of outbound messaging, new posting creation, or candidate access for a defined period. Existing conversations may be paused.
  • Strike 3 — Removal. Permanent removal of the recruiter, and where appropriate the associated company account, from Cache.

Some violations are severe enough to skip the strike ladder and trigger immediate suspension pending review:

  • Requesting money from a candidate.
  • Harassment, threats, or discriminatory conduct.
  • Selling, leaking, or otherwise misusing candidate data.
  • Impersonating a company or another person.
  • Attempts to defraud candidates or the platform.

Strikes stay on record for twelve months from the date of the decision. Recruiters may appeal any strike or suspension by replying to the notification email within fourteen days.
